CRUISE holidays from the UK to the Mediterranean are back in the top 5 holiday bookings for families facing financial restraints says Advantage Travel.
Old favourite foreign hotspots are back in fashion again for future holidays, it was revealed today. Florida and cruise ship holidays to the Mediterranean are also proving popular as tourists search for good-value breaks. Advantage Travel Centres commercial director Julia Lo Bue-Said said: "There's no doubt that consumers are looking closely at their holiday spend. Families understandably want the very best deals they can get, but they also want the reassurance that they will have an enjoyable break. "That's why the established destinations are seeing strong sales. The infrastructure and weather are good and they are well served by tour operators. Heading off to a less-established destination obviously has a degree of uncertainty attached to it, and people don't want to take that risk if they are only going abroad once next year." The company expects Spain to do particularly well next year as there has been a surge in the number of Britons buying property there and cash-strapped friends and relatives may well want to join the new owners so they can "get away on the cheap".
